PN25 Double Disk Check Valve Fig. 37

– According to EN-12334.
– Face to face dimensions according to EN 558-1 Serie 16. API 609.
– Valve for mounting between flanges according to UNE-EN 1092-2 PN25

CHARACTERISTICS:

– Double disk and seat design for optimum sealing.
– Springs with elongated and curved supports that offer a longer life.
– Minimal wear of the seat and disks.
– Excellent work in various mounting orientations.
– It has a low maintenance cost.
– Its minimum weight and compact design can reduce weight on the line.
– Ideal for installation in vertical pipes.
– It has an easy installation and removal.
– Eye bolt available between size Ø250 to Ø600 to facilitate the centering and
assembly of the valve.
